diff --git a/flake.nix b/flake.nix index a53e28a..0e21f56 100644 --- a/flake.nix +++ b/flake.nix @@ -27,6 +27,7 @@ vim = modules/vim.nix; zsh = modules/zsh.nix; git = modules/git.nix; + udiskie = modules/udiskie.nix; }; overlays.default = final: prev: { diff --git a/modules/udiskie.nix b/modules/udiskie.nix new file mode 100644 index 0000000..972cce9 --- /dev/null +++ b/modules/udiskie.nix @@ -0,0 +1,12 @@ +{ pkgs, ... }: +{ + systemd.user.services.udiskie = { + after = [ "udisks2.service" ]; + wants = [ "udisks2.service" ]; + wantedBy = [ "graphical-session.target" ]; + serviceConfig = { + ExecStart = "${pkgs.udiskie}/bin/udiskie --verbose --no-config --notify"; + }; + }; + services.udisks2.enable = true; +}